Data-driven health management: reasoning about personally generated data in diabetes with information technologies

Conclusion Overall, the study showed that identifying trends in the data collected with self-monitoring is a complex process, and that conclusions reached by both individuals with diabetes and diabetes educators are not always reliable. This suggests the need for new ways to facilitate individuals’ reasoning with informatics interventions.
